Transaction 0686939659f4e427c292fe636186cd5bed3a2ab94f5f515d5264047537566742

1 Input
2 Outputs
  • 0686939659f4e427c292fe636186cd5bed3a2ab94f5f515d5264047537566742:0
  • value  21366
    address  3CRL378ddfppf2CxHQdqUUAEaMPGyNcvAz
  • 0686939659f4e427c292fe636186cd5bed3a2ab94f5f515d5264047537566742:1
  • value  411307
    address  13RZRUzZ19VNMTBfkkP8Do1rvbt9gE9bzA